Workplace Safety and Occupational Injury Reporting Quiz

#1

What is the primary goal of workplace safety?

Protect employees from harm
Explanation

Safety measures aim to prevent harm to workers.

#2

Which of the following is a common ergonomic hazard in the workplace?

Repetitive strain injuries
Explanation

Repetitive tasks can lead to strain injuries.

#3

What is the role of a Safety Committee in a workplace?

Reviewing and promoting safety measures
Explanation

Committees oversee safety protocols and advocate improvements.

#4

What is the purpose of a Near Miss Report in the context of workplace safety?

To document incidents that almost resulted in injury or damage
Explanation

Helps in identifying potential hazards and preventing accidents.

#5

Which organization is responsible for setting workplace safety standards in the United States?

OSHA
Explanation

OSHA (Occupational Safety and Health Administration) sets standards.

#6

What does MSDS stand for in the context of workplace safety?

Material Safety Data Sheet
Explanation

MSDS provides details about hazardous materials.

#7

What is the purpose of a Safety Data Sheet (SDS) in the workplace?

To provide information on hazardous chemicals
Explanation

SDS offers crucial details about chemical hazards.

#8

What does PPE stand for in the context of workplace safety?

Personal Protective Equipment
Explanation

PPE safeguards workers from workplace hazards.

#9

Which of the following is a common electrical safety practice in the workplace?

Regularly inspecting and maintaining equipment
Explanation

Routine checks prevent electrical hazards.

#10

What is the purpose of a Safety Audit in the workplace?

Reviewing and improving safety procedures
Explanation

Audits identify areas for safety enhancement.

#11

In the event of a workplace injury, when should it be reported?

As soon as possible
Explanation

Prompt reporting helps in timely action and prevention.

#12

What is the purpose of a Job Safety Analysis (JSA) in the workplace?

To identify and mitigate workplace hazards
Explanation

JSA helps in recognizing and controlling risks.

#13

What is the 'Hierarchy of Controls' in the context of hazard mitigation?

A priority system for controlling workplace hazards
Explanation

It's a systematic approach to hazard management.

#14

What is the purpose of an Emergency Evacuation Plan in the workplace?

To guide employees during emergencies
Explanation

Evacuation plans ensure swift and safe exits.

#15

What does the acronym R.I.C.E. stand for in the context of first aid for injuries?

Rest, Ice, Compression, Elevation
Explanation

R.I.C.E. aids in initial injury management.

#16

Why is it important to have a Lockout/Tagout procedure in the workplace?

To control hazardous energy sources during maintenance
Explanation

Prevents accidental equipment start-up during maintenance.
